of: of_node_get()/of_node_put() nodes held in phandle cache

The phandle cache contains struct device_node pointers.  The refcount
of the pointers was not incremented while in the cache, allowing use
after free error after kfree() of the node.  Add the proper increment
and decrement of the use count.

Fixes: 0b3ce78e90 ("of: cache phandle nodes to reduce cost of of_find_node_by_phandle()")
Cc: stable@vger.kernel.org # v4.17+
Signed-off-by: Frank Rowand <frank.rowand@sony.com>
Signed-off-by: Rob Herring <robh@kernel.org>
